    The specific challenges of a romantic relationship with someone addicted to alcohol

    Entering into a relationship with someone struggling with alcoholism means navigating a world of often-broken promises, fragile communication, and emotional instability. The complexity of this situation creates multiple challenges for the non-alcoholic partner.

    Damaged Communication

    Speech between spouses becomes a laborious dance where every word can be misinterpreted, transformed by the shadow alcohol casts on perception. The alcoholic’s explanations about their drinking are often minimized or shrouded in ambiguity. The words “I don’t drink too much” or “I can stop whenever I want” resonate without conviction, while the partner tries to decipher the truth behind these statements.

    Emotional Turmoil and Loss of Trust

    Mood fluctuations, ranging from moments of tenderness to outbursts of anger, undermine emotional stability. In many cases, trust is the first pillar to collapse. Alcohol undermines reliability, causes forgetfulness, broken promises, and creates a lingering uncertainty about the future of the relationship.

    The Emotional Burden of the Sober Partner

    Beyond understanding, the “sober” partner often bears the weight of intense stress, which can lead to isolation, profound sadness, and mental exhaustion. Managing emergency situations, such as bouts of alcohol abuse, requires constant vigilance, which ultimately takes a heavy toll on emotional health.

    Prospects for Recovery and Hope in a Relationship Marked by Alcoholism

    Faced with the influence of alcohol in a romantic relationship, many hopes arise around possible paths to recovery. While some people affected by addiction express a genuine desire to begin recovery, it is imperative that this desire be authentic and supported. The Decisive Role of Personal Will

    Since alcoholism is a complex illness, it can only be effectively combated when the person concerned recognizes their problem and commits to a process of change. Externally imposed attempts without this consent often remain futile and counterproductive.

    Different Therapeutic Options

    In 2025, the range of available care is broad and adapted to the uniqueness of each patient. It includes:

    Withdrawal treatments, in a hospital setting or at home, to break the physical addiction.

    Individual psychotherapy

    • to understand the emotional roots of addiction.Family or couples therapy
    • to rebuild emotional relationships and improve communication. Support groups
    • such as Alcoholics Anonymous, which offer valuable solidarity. Types of Care

    Faced with a situation fraught with uncertainty and suffering, it is essential for the non-alcoholic partner to take a clear-eyed and thoughtful approach to decide whether to stay or leave. This crucial choice depends on several determining factors. Assess Your Mental and Emotional Health Personal well-being must be the priority. When the relationship becomes synonymous with chronic stress, profound sadness, or depression, preserving your own emotional health is a strong signal to consider.

    Encourage and Support Professional Care

    It is important to encourage, without forcing, the partner to seek help and support, while being prepared to provide support without erasing yourself.

    Establish Clear Boundaries for Self-Protection

    Defining clear boundaries can take the form of a temporary separation or a specific restriction in your life together to promote healing.

    Seek external support

    Not facing this ordeal alone is essential. Relying on family, friends, or specialized groups helps prevent isolation and maintain effective inner strength.

    https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=eNuCVQUKIgsFrequently Asked Questions About Alcohol and Romantic RelationshipsHow can you talk about alcoholism with your partner without hurting their feelings?

    Favoring “I”-based communication, expressing your feelings without judgment, and offering open dialogue can facilitate a constructive approach. Does alcohol always make relationships more difficult? Not necessarily. Moderate and conscious consumption, with brands like Pernod Ricard or Veuve Clicquot, can pleasantly accompany shared moments, provided that it does not become systematic.

    What are the warning signs in a relationship?

    Frequency of use, loss of control, repeated conflicts and social isolation are important indicators to monitor.
    Is separation the only solution to severe alcoholism?

    Not always. The desire for change, appropriate therapeutic support, and sincere communication can allow the couple to overcome this ordeal.
